New Members
New members can refer to the wiki home page and quickly find background info on the team's seasonal goals, onboarding processes, tutorials, and most importantly a list of ongoing and past projects.
Project Documentation
When working on a project, team members must collect information on their project and produce a standard project document to finalize the completion of their project. Follow the Project Template.
